I just bought a rear bag, and it needs some more sand. It is filled with heavy sand, and I really do not need to add any more weight, I just need to have it filled better so it does not sag.

Can I add regular play sand to it? or do I need to get the same kind of sand so that it feels the same?


1 more thing... do you have any really nice tips for filling other that just placing a funnel in the tube, and letting it pour?
 
Poke it with a chop stick really good to help pack it in while your filling it
If you don't have heavy sand, play sand will be OK, but some kinds of it have been know to attract moisture .....
